About Jerry T. Miller

Jerry was born in Louisville, raised near Fisherville, and lives in Eastwood. He began his career as a CPA and worked for 31 years in the private sector, most of that time with Humana.
In 2004, he joined Governor Fletcher’s Administration, working with Commerce Secretary Jim Host on issues affecting Louisville, including the new downtown Arena. In 2006, Jerry was appointed Commissioner of Kentucky State Parks.
Elected to Metro Council in 2010, he has been a member of Middletown-area Christian churches for over 30 years. An avid history buff, he enjoys bicycling, hiking, and paddle sports. He lives in Eastwood with Laura, his wife of 38 years. They have a daughter, Jessica, son-in-law Matt, and two-year-old granddaughter Kate.
